技术文摘
学习大数据技术:MySQL与Oracle的应用范围及适用场景
学习大数据技术:MySQL与Oracle的应用范围及适用场景
在大数据技术的学习过程中,数据库的选择至关重要。MySQL与Oracle作为两款备受瞩目的数据库管理系统,有着各自独特的应用范围和适用场景。
MySQL以其开源、轻量级的特性,在众多领域中广泛应用。对于互联网初创企业和小型项目而言,MySQL是绝佳选择。它的安装与维护成本较低,易于上手,能够快速搭建起数据存储与管理的架构。例如,一些小型电商平台,初期数据量相对较小,业务逻辑也不太复杂,使用MySQL可以高效地处理订单数据、用户信息等,助力业务快速发展。在一些对成本敏感的大数据分析项目中,MySQL凭借其强大的存储引擎和灵活的查询功能,也能承担起数据存储与初步分析的重任。像一些小型数据公司进行简单的市场调研数据分析时,MySQL就能够很好地满足需求。
Oracle则凭借其强大的性能、高度的稳定性和安全性,在大型企业和关键业务系统中占据重要地位。大型金融机构,如银行的核心业务系统,涉及大量的资金交易、客户信息管理等,对数据的完整性和安全性要求极高。Oracle的高级安全特性,如强大的用户认证、数据加密功能等,能够确保数据的安全无虞。而且,它具备强大的处理大规模数据和高并发事务的能力,能够应对银行系统每天海量的交易数据处理。另外,在电信、能源等大型企业的运营支撑系统中,Oracle也发挥着关键作用,保证业务的稳定运行。
MySQL适合预算有限、对性能要求不是极高、数据量相对较小且追求快速开发的场景;而Oracle更适用于对数据安全、稳定性和处理能力要求苛刻,预算充足的大型企业级应用。在学习大数据技术时,深入了解MySQL与Oracle的应用范围及适用场景,能帮助我们根据实际需求做出更合适的数据库选择,为大数据项目的成功实施奠定坚实基础 。
- 开发者眼中好文档的重要意义
- 拉链式与线性探测式散列表在 Map 中的实现
- C 语言数据类型转换零基础轻松上手:自动与强制转换教程
- 一道诡异的 JS 面试题与“作用域”及“提升”
- Python 提取 Excel 内容:新奇需求,千表仅需十行代码
- Nodejs 系列:运用 V8 编写 C++插件
- 深度剖析 Go 程序启动流程,g0 和 m0 你了解吗?
- 一次敖丙 Dubbo 线程池事故排查记录
- 2021 年程序员必具的 9 项技能
- 1534K Star!前十前端开源项目的开源内容大揭秘
- Java 编程之数据结构与算法中的「递归」
- Java 中 Unsafe 的详细使用
- 2021 年最受欢迎编程语言排行:Objective-C 被 Swift 取代
- 实现前端业务组件库的三个关键要点
- 深入剖析 SpringMVC 异常处理体系